Design Patterns for Modules

When crafting robust and maintainable software architectures, adhering to best practices in module injection design patterns is crucial. One fundamental principle is strictness in defining dependencies. Modules should precisely outline their required dependencies, fostering a clear understanding of relationships between components. Utilizing abstraction mechanisms, such as interfaces or abstract classes, promotes loose coupling and enhances the flexibility of your codebase.

  • Enforce dependency injection over tightly coupled designs to reduce dependencies between modules.
  • Aim for a modular architecture where each module has a singular purpose and minimal external dependencies.
  • Employ inversion of control principles, allowing the framework or application to manage object creation and dependency resolution.

By adhering to these best practices, you can build software systems that are more robust, easier to test, and readily adaptable to evolving requirements.
